This multi-generational novel ranges over the history of the Hudson River Valley from the late seventeenth century to the late s with low humor, high seriousness, and magical, almost hallucinatory prose. Thomas Coraghessan Boyle, also known as T. C. Boyle and T. Coraghessan Boyle (born December 2, ), is an American novelist and short story writer. Since the mids, he has published sixteen novels and more than short stories. He won the PEN/Faulkner award in , for his third novel, World's End, which recounts years in upstate New York..
